SECONDARY MEDIA
To connect an AUI cable to your adapter, attach an external
transceiver to the network segment to which the adapter is going
to be attached. Refer to the applicable transceiver manual. Attach
the female end of an AUI cable, no more than 50 meters in length,
to the transceiver.
Attach the male connector on the AUI cable to the adapter’s AUI
port and tighten the securing screws.

3.3
CONNECTING TO A FIBER OPTIC LINK
The physical communication link consists of two fiber optic
strands between the adapter and the other Ethernet fiber optic
device on the link: Transmit (TX) and Receive (RX).
The adapter Tx connects to the Rx of the Ethernet device. The
adapter Rx connects to Tx of the Ethernet device.
